The TIC126D-S belongs to the category of silicon controlled rectifiers (SCRs), which are semiconductor devices used for controlling large amounts of electrical power.
It is commonly used in applications requiring high-power switching, such as motor control, lighting control, and power supplies.
The TIC126D-S is typically available in a TO-220AB package, which provides efficient heat dissipation and easy mounting on heat sinks.

The TIC126D-S typically has three pins: 1. Anode (A) 2. Cathode (K) 3. Gate (G)
The TIC126D-S operates based on the principle of controlling the flow of current through the device by triggering the gate terminal. When the gate trigger current is applied, the SCR turns on and conducts current until the load current falls below the holding current.
The TIC126D-S can be used in motor control applications to regulate the speed and direction of motors in industrial machinery, appliances, and automotive systems.
In lighting control systems, the TIC126D-S can be employed to adjust the intensity of incandescent or halogen lamps, as well as in dimmer switches for residential and commercial lighting.
For power supply units, the TIC126D-S can serve as a key component in regulating and converting electrical power for various electronic devices and equipment.
